Transaction 5887a77738e99fd435e705995875a7c132feb493e9528a464d534fe6335e92b7
1 Input
1 Output
-
5887a77738e99fd435e705995875a7c132feb493e9528a464d534fe6335e92b7:0
- value
- 633559600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44dae686085efce5d5c5c7f41b6eef4f9c0dc584 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17H5BWxzcc4EMYQ6QWoGhBvt1CCQGsAR9i